OG 7.1 Silent letters kn, wr
|
knot |
The knot was too tight to undo.
|
|
knit |
Helen is going to knit a jacket for her sister's baby,.
|
|
knife |
The knife is made of stainless steel.
|
|
know |
Did you know him well?
|
|
knee |
I have a bruise on my knee.
